How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Ledbetter?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Ledbetter Studio Apartments | $850 | $825 | $875 |
Ledbetter 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,406 | $699 | $3,040 |
Ledbetter 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,494 | $720 | $3,588 |
Ledbetter 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,515 | $679 | $4,845 |
Ledbetter 4 Bedroom Apartments | $817 | $599 | $3,200 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Ledbetter
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Ledbetter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Ledbetter ranges from $699 to $3,040 with an average monthly rent of $1,406.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Ledbetter c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Ledbetter range from $720 to $3,588.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,494.
How expensive are Ledbetter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 21 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Ledbetter on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$679 to $4,845 - averaging $1,515 for the location.
